Setaro Surname Meaning

Italian: occupational name for a silk weaver spinner or worker from an agent derivative of seta ‘silk’.

Source: Dictionary of American Family Names 2nd edition, 2022

Where is the Setaro family from?

You can see how Setaro families moved over time by selecting different census years. The Setaro family name was found in the USA, and Canada between 1880 and 1920. The most Setaro families were found in USA in 1920. In 1911 there were 3 Setaro families living in British Columbia. This was about 50% of all the recorded Setaro's in Canada. British Columbia had the highest population of Setaro families in 1911.

What did your Setaro ancestors do for a living?

In 1940, Laborer and Bookkeeper were the top reported jobs for men and women in the USA named Setaro. 38% of Setaro men worked as a Laborer and 20% of Setaro women worked as a Bookkeeper. Some less common occupations for Americans named Setaro were Bartender and Stenographer.

What is the average Setaro lifespan?

Between 1949 and 2004, in the United States, Setaro life expectancy was at its lowest point in 1977, and highest in 1998. The average life expectancy for Setaro in 1949 was 66, and 67 in 2004.
